Prosecutor
An attorney who conducts the case against a defendant in a criminal court.
Imputed
Attribute something, especially a thought or action, to a person or entity based on the actions or thoughts of another related or connected person or entity.
Computer Fraud
The act of using computers or digital devices to commit fraudulent activities such as identity theft, embezzlement, or unauthorized access to data.
Fraudulent Transfer
A transfer of property made with intent to defraud creditors or made for an amount significantly lower than the property’s fair market value within two years of filing for bankruptcy.
